Excel工作表格怎么插入日历?如何快速添加?
作者:佚名|分类:EXCEL|浏览:123|发布时间:2025-03-25 07:01:39
Excel工作表格怎么插入日历?如何快速添加?
在Excel中插入日历是一个常见的需求,无论是为了规划时间、记录事件还是进行数据分析,日历的插入都能大大提高工作效率。以下是如何在Excel中插入日历以及如何快速添加的详细步骤。
如何插入日历
1. 使用“插入”选项卡
1. 打开Excel工作簿。
2. 在顶部菜单栏中,点击“插入”选项卡。
3. 在“表格”组中,选择“日历”。
4. 在弹出的“日历”对话框中,你可以选择不同的日历视图,如日、周、月等。
5. 选择好视图后,点击“确定”按钮,日历就会插入到当前活动单元格下方。
2. 使用“开发工具”选项卡
如果你的Excel版本中“插入”选项卡没有“日历”选项,你可以通过以下步骤来插入:
1. 在Excel的任意位置右键点击,选择“开发工具”。
2. 如果“开发工具”选项卡未显示,请先启用它。在Excel选项中,选择“自定义功能区”,勾选“开发工具”,然后点击“确定”。
3. 在“开发工具”选项卡中,点击“控件”组中的“插入”按钮。
4. 在弹出的控件列表中,选择“ActiveX控件”。
5. 在工作表上拖动以创建一个矩形区域,这将作为日历的容器。
6. 在弹出的“属性”窗口中,找到“Class”属性,将其设置为“Calendar”。
7. 点击“确定”按钮,日历就会显示在工作表中。
如何快速添加日历
为了快速添加日历,你可以将插入日历的步骤设置为快捷键或宏。
1. 设置快捷键
1. 按下`Alt + F11`键打开VBA编辑器。
2. 在“插入”菜单中选择“模块”。
3. 在打开的代码窗口中,输入以下代码:
```vba
Sub InsertCalendar()
With ActiveSheet
.Cells(1, 1).Insert Shift:=xlDown, CopyOrigin:=xlFormatFromLeftOrAbove
.Cells(1, 1).Value = "日历"
.Cells(2, 1).Insert Shift:=xlToRight, CopyOrigin:=xlFormatFromLeftOrAbove
.Cells(2, 1).Value = "日期"
.Cells(2, 2).Value = Date
End With
End Sub
```
4. 关闭VBA编辑器,返回Excel。
5. 按下`Alt + F8`,选择“InsertCalendar”,然后点击“运行”按钮。
2. 创建宏
1. 按下`Alt + F8`打开“宏”对话框。
2. 点击“创建”按钮,给宏命名,例如“快速日历”。
3. 点击“确定”。
4. 按下`Alt + F11`打开VBA编辑器,重复上述步骤1-3,将宏代码粘贴到模块中。
5. 关闭VBA编辑器,返回Excel。
6. 再次按下`Alt + F8`,选择“快速日历”,然后点击“运行”按钮。
相关问答
1. 为什么我在“插入”选项卡中没有找到“日历”选项?
答:这可能是由于你的Excel版本不支持该功能,或者“日历”选项被禁用了。你可以尝试使用ActiveX控件的方法来插入日历。
2. 如何更改日历的格式?
答:插入日历后,你可以通过右键点击日历,选择“设置单元格格式”来更改日期的格式。
3. 如何在日历中添加事件?
答:在日历中添加事件需要使用Excel的“条件格式”功能。你可以选择特定日期,然后应用条件格式,比如设置背景颜色或添加图标。
通过以上步骤,你可以在Excel中轻松插入和快速添加日历,从而提高你的工作效率。